For those joining us for the first time, or those who may have forgotten I'll explain how all of this works.
Every "week" (in quotes because it's not always a calendar week. Game "weeks" are sometimes more and sometimes less) I will post a prompt. Usually with some sort of vague explanation and a deadline.
That prompt is your springboard. You can take it and do whatever you want with it. Use it as your inspiration.
You then write your entry and post it in your space (DW, LJ, blog, wherever), posting a link to that entry in the Prompt post for that week. (Which is why I had people practice this action in the Sign Up Sheet)
I previously announced that this mini season has two "byes", for those not familiar with the sports term, when a team has a "bye week" that means they don't play. Life happens. Maybe you just can't get anything creative done that week due to (insert annoying thing happening here) or maybe you just don't feel like it... either way, you get 2 of these between now and the Top 20. Use them wisely. Just post the word "bye week" instead of your entry. You *can* change your mind before the deadline, but please send me a personal message. Otherwise I might not see it.
My usual suggestion is that once people start posting entries, you should start reading them. That way you don't have to try to fit everything in and get overwhelmed. My usual banter is "Read, Comment and Vote for your favorites!"
I gather those links and place them in a poll. I post that poll with a deadline for how long everyone has to read and vote. The word "Vote" or "Voting" should be in the subject line as well as the tag for those who like to set alerts.
You can vote for as many entries (or few) as you like. Whoever has the lowest amounts of votes that week is eliminated from the competition.
and we move forward onward into the next week...
